About the role

IDEAYA is a precision medicine oncology company dedicated to discovering, developing, and commercializing transformative therapies for cancer. The Senior Director, Trade, Channel, & Distribution will oversee the launch and ongoing management of the darovasertib distribution network in the US.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ute a comprehensive trade, channel, and distribution strategy for darovasertib
  • Manage and establish relationships with trade and distribution partners
  • Ensure compliance with federal and state laws and maintain audit readiness
  • Monitor inventory levels and product flow, and enhance program performance post-launch
  • Attend customer meetings, manage implementation, and lead business review meetings
  • Evaluate and implement contracting strategies with key customer segments
  • Lead the Pricing Committee and ensure compliance with required governance and SOPs
  • Oversee compliance with trade agreements, payer, and provider contracts
  • Collaborate with Finance to ensure timely data reporting and payments
  • Design, implement, and manage returned goods policy and processes
  • Oversee budgeting and financial planning for distribution and channel activities
